The Saudi club Al-Hilal closes the transfer of Neymar for 90 million euros

Saudi club Al-Hilal closed a two-year transfer deal with Brazilian player Neymar, according to Saudi outlet Arriyadiyah. The contract includes 90 million euros for PSG and 100 million euros per season for Neymar.

As reported by the newspaper L’Équipe, and confirmed by Le Parisien, all the parties involved agree to close the deal that includes, in addition to around 90 million euros for Paris Saint-Germaina contract for the Brazilian for whom he would charge around 100 million euros per season.

With these data, it would be the most valuable sale operation in the history of PSG.

Neymar has played 173 games with the French club, to which has helped win 13 trophies, including five League 1 titles.

Neymar, although has guided the Parisians to the Champions League final in 2020 and to the semi-finals in 2021has often missed important tournaments due to serious physical problems.

Neymar, who left Barcelona to sign for PSG six years ago for a world record transfer, was not part of coach Luis Enrique’s plans for the new season.

The Brazilian was not called up by Luis Enrique for the game of the first day of Ligue 1 against Lorient.
